Financial administrative occupations n.e.c. vs Telecoms and related network installers and repairers Salary (2025)

How do Financial administrative occupations n.e.c. and Telecoms and related network installers and repairers sal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Telecoms and related network installers and repairers earns £12,314 more per year (46% higher)
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ricFinancial administrative occupations n.e.c.Telecoms and related network installers and repairersDifference
Median Annual£26,774£39,088-£12,314
Mean Annual£26,601£41,196-£14,595
Monthly£2,231£3,257-£1,026
Weekly£515£752-£237
Hourly£12.87£18.79-£5.92

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ileFinancial administrative occupations n.e.c.Telecoms and related network installers and repairers
10th (Entry)£10,926£28,360
25th£18,096£34,100
50th (Median)£26,774£39,088
75th£31,960£45,151
